Method
Preparation
- In a large bowl, dissolve yeast and sugar in warm water, then let it sit for 5-10 minutes until foamy.
- Stir in the olive oil, flour, and salt, mixing until a shaggy dough forms.
Kneading and Rising
-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and knead for 5-7 minutes until it is smooth and elastic.
- Place the dough in a lightly oiled bowl, cover it with plastic wrap, and let it rise in a warm place for 1 hour, or until doubled in size.
Shaping and Baking
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and lightly grease a baking sheet.
- Punch down the risen dough, divide it into 7 equal pieces, and roll each piece into a 8-10 inch long rope.
- Arrange the breadsticks on the prepared ba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until golden brown.
Finishing (optional)
- For a flavorful topping, combine melted butter, garlic powder, and grated Parmesan cheese.
- Brush the warm breadsticks with the butter mixture before serving.
Notes
For extra flavor, you can add herbs like dried oregano or Italian seasoning to the dough. These breadsticks are best served warm and can be stored in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Reheat in the oven for a few minutes before serving to restore their crispness.
